[QUOTE="krish, post: 749730, member: 2903"] Woah guys, sorry for dropping off this thread but was busy getting married among other things! I went ahead and got a set of prints for that supercharger design that Hyde from NZ developed (M52supercharged.wordpress now known as hydemotorworks link here [URL="https://hydemotorworks.com/"]https://hydemotorworks.com/[/URL] . He's done good work, very detailed, exact measurements and everything fit as it should. I ended up laser cutting the brackets out of stainless steel plate :), managed to source an SC14 from mudah, and finished the whole thing just last month in fact (over a course of 6 months mainly working evenings).Among the things I had to do was to remove the power steering pump and bracket, fit the SC bracket then bolt the PS pump back on. Also relocate the power steering fluid container, redirect some water hoses. I also had to remove the viscous fan and fitted a thermo switch controlled electric fan as per Hyde's directions. Mixed feelings on the results. She's got a fair bit more go now but think there should be more available once I get a proper tune down. Any one know of anyone who can flash tune the DME MS41? I suspect fueling is low. I'm only running around 5 psi of boost but even then....best to check and see. A lot more grunt but downside is that supercharger is noisy. Probably won't notice it as much in a 3 or 5 especially with a performance exhaust I guess, but the 7 is/was serene :) . cheers, Kris [/QUOTE]
